How Life Works Here
Defender Drive is located in North East Lincolnshire, near Grimsby. Crime levels are below the local average (67 incidents in 12 months).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. The nearest transport stop is 276m away (bus). Rail links may require a connecting journey. The median property price is £191,000, with strong growth of 16% over five years. Based on 28 transactions recorded since 2014. There are 5 schools within 2 km, 4 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. Primary schools are nearby, though secondary options may require travel. This street may particularly suit property investors. Market indicators suggest an upward trend. Overall, this street scores 51 out of 100 for liveability, placing it in the top 20% within its district.
